网络请求超时是指客户端发送请求后,因未在预设时间内收到服务器响应而出现的错误状态。以下是常见的原因及解决方法:
一、网络连接问题
-
物理连接故障
- 检查网线是否插好,路由器或交换机是否正常工作,尝试更换设备或线路。
-
网络拥堵或信号弱
- 通过其他网络应用(如QQ)测试连接,或尝试重启路由器。
-
DNS解析问题
- 检查DNS设置,尝试使用
nslookup
或dig
命令测试域名解析。
- 检查DNS设置,尝试使用
二、服务器或网络设备问题
-
服务器负载过高
- 服务器维护、硬件故障或DDoS攻击可能导致响应延迟,需联系管理员处理。
-
网络设备故障
- 路由器、交换机故障可尝试重启设备(关闭电源10分钟后再启动)或恢复出厂设置。
-
运营商问题
- 联系网络服务商测试线路或咨询维护状态。
三、客户端问题
-
软件冲突或配置错误
- 检查防火墙设置,确保允许ICMP请求通过;更新或重置浏览器。
-
系统资源不足
- 关闭不必要的后台程序,释放内存和CPU资源。
-
恶意软件或病毒感染
- 运行杀毒软件全盘扫描,清除异常程序。
四、其他原因
-
协议不匹配 :客户端与服务器协议版本不一致,需检查协议配置。
-
网络策略限制 :企业网络可能限制ICMP请求,需咨询网络管理员。
解决步骤建议
-
初步排查 :通过
ping
命令测试网络连通性,结合错误代码定位问题。 -
分段测试 :关闭防火墙或代理服务器,观察是否恢复连接。
-
联系支持 :若上述方法无效,联系网络服务商或服务器管理员。
通过以上步骤,多数网络请求超时问题可得到解决。若问题持续存在,建议提供具体错误代码或场景以便进一步分析。